Lanzar is what I would call an excellent underground brand. Their name isn't as popular in car audio circles as Kicker, Fosgate, JL Audio, etc. People remember them for being taken over by Sound Around but not for their association with Steven Mantz (ZED Audio) for a very long time before the takeover. Good solid brand with their cheap lines like every other brand. Their Optidrive is competitive with Kicker, RF Power Series, JL Audio Slash series, etc.
